Your Course Prep
Since this course isn’t for total newbies, make sure you’re set with these social media basics before you sign up:
Twitter:
- Understand Twitter language: @mentions, RT, link shorteners, etc. If you don’t, here’s a cheat sheet.
- Complete your profile. That means a bio, photo (headshot is best) and link to your blog. If you don’t have a blog, link to your LinkedIn profile. Not sure what to write about in your bio? Check out this post from social media thug Marian Schembari.
- Have tweeted at least 10 quality (aka valuable to your followers) tweets.
Facebook:
- Know your Facebook policy. Do you friend only people you know in real life? Or do you accept requests from online friends, like those you meet on Twitter? Would you befriend your boss, or only non-professional contacts?
- Be active! Talk to people once in a while.
LinkedIn:
- Fill out your profile completely. That means you should have a photo, work history and summary, at the very least.
